      Illustrating the tension of politics in contemporary Belgium, this title chronicles the growth of Belgium throughout the past 2 centuries. It shows how these two cultures - the economically, politically, and culturally less- developed Flemish majority and the Walloon minority - underwent a process of equalization that brought about a federal model.

      The authors of this historical survey endeavor to describe the different stages of language dominance in all its complexity. The first aim is to define this evolution to the socio-political and cultural relationships in Belgium and the general linguistic and political strategies as they were and have always been put into effect throughout the world.
